Authentic Korean Food · Authentic Korean Snack

Gosomi is one of Korea's most iconic crackers, first launched in 1979 and beloved in Korean households for over 40 years. These thin, crispy biscuits are made with wheat flour, sesame, and coconut, delivering a lightly salted, subtly sweet flavour with a rich, toasty sesame aroma from the very first bite. In Korea, Gosomi is the classic companion to a cup of tea or coffee — a timeless everyday snack.

Ingredients · Ingredients

Wheat flour, Sugar, Sunflower Seed Oil, Coconut Oil, Shortening, Coconut Powder, Sesame, Whey Powder, Milk Powder, Raising agents (Ammonium hydrogen carbonate E503, Sodium hydrogen carbonate E500), Palm Oil, Salt, Dextrose, Rice Powder, Natural Calcium, Salt seasoning (Salt, Corn), Artificial flavourings (Coconut flavour, Artificial milk flavour), Cheese Powder, Xanthan Gum E415, Sodium Metabisulfite E221.

⚠️ Allergen Information · Información sobre alérgenos

Mandatory allergen declaration under EU Regulation 1169/2011 — the following allergens are present in this product.

Gluten (Wheat) Milk (Whey · Milk Powder) Sesame Sulphites (E221)

How Koreans Enjoy It · Recetas Coreanas

Discover the many ways Gosomi is enjoyed in Korean homes — from a light everyday snack to a creative dessert topping, all true to authentic Korean style.

With Coffee
커피와 함께
The most classic way to enjoy Gosomi in Korea. Around 3 in the afternoon, Koreans pair a whole pack with a warm Americano or latte. The toasty sesame flavour gently softens the bitterness of coffee, making Gosomi the perfect coffee-time companion — much like biscotti or petit beurre in Europe.
With Korean Tea
한국 차와 함께
The traditional Korean pairing is with barley tea (boricha), corn tea (oksusucha), or brown rice green tea. The earthy, grain-forward notes of Korean tea blend naturally with the sesame and coconut aroma of Gosomi, creating a calm and warming afternoon moment.
Lunchbox Snack
도시락 간식
A go-to snack for Korean students and office workers to carry in their bags. Small and light yet satisfying enough for a whole pack, Gosomi is the ideal desk drawer snack to reach for between lunch and dinner when hunger strikes.
Movie Night
영화 볼 때 야식
On weekend evenings in Korean homes, Gosomi often appears on the living room table when the family gathers to watch a drama or film. Its well-balanced salty-sweet flavour makes it a popular alternative to salty popcorn — or a great snack to enjoy alongside it.
With Milk
우유에 적셔서
A favourite way for Korean children to enjoy Gosomi. Dipped briefly into cold milk for a softer texture, or paired with warm milk as a light bedtime snack. The sesame and coconut flavours bloom even more gently when combined with milk.
Ice Cream Topping
아이스크림 토핑
A creative dessert idea inspired by Korean cafés. Crumble Gosomi over a scoop of vanilla ice cream and you have a Korean-style crumble dessert with added sesame and coconut aroma. A simple way to bring a café-style treat into your own home.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
What kind of snack is Orion Gosomi? What does it taste and feel like?

Gosomi is a thin, crispy cracker-style biscuit made by Orion, one of Korea's most iconic snack brands. The name "Gosomi" comes from the Korean word "gosohada" (nutty/toasty), and the biscuit is made primarily with sesame and coconut powder, giving it a rich, nutty flavour with a hint of sweetness. The texture is lighter and crispier than a European shortbread, with a well-balanced salty-sweet profile. It can be enjoyed on its own as a snack, or paired with cheese and dips.

Does Gosomi contain any allergens?

Yes. Gosomi contains the following 4 allergens from the 14 major allergens listed under EU Regulation EC 1169/2011: ① Gluten — contains wheat flour, ② Milk — contains whey powder, milk powder, and cheese powder, ③ Sesame — included as a direct ingredient, ④ Sulphites — contains sodium metabisulfite (E221). If you have an allergy to any of the above, please avoid consumption. Always check the physical product label before purchase.

Is Gosomi suitable for vegans or vegetarians?

No, Gosomi is not a vegan product. It contains animal-derived dairy ingredients including whey powder, milk powder, and cheese powder. Suitability for vegetarians has not been confirmed. Some distribution information suggests the shortening ingredient may contain beef tallow. Vegetarians and those following a halal diet are advised to confirm the current batch ingredients directly with the manufacturer before consuming. There is no halal certification.

Is Gosomi gluten-free?

No, Gosomi is not gluten-free. Wheat flour is used as a primary ingredient, so the product contains gluten. Those with coeliac disease or gluten sensitivity should avoid consumption.

How should Gosomi be stored, and how long does it stay fresh after opening?

Store Gosomi in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. After opening, transfer to an airtight container or resealable bag to preserve the crispy texture, and consume within 1–2 days if possible. In humid environments (e.g. a European kitchen in summer), the crackers may soften more quickly. For the best-before date of an unopened pack, please refer to the date printed on the product packaging.
